Fast Mitigation Methods
Because water damage can intensify swiftly, reacting promptly is vital to decreasing its effects. Act quick when you discover leaks or flooding. Initially, transform off the water resource when possible. Next off, remove any type of useful things or furnishings from the afflicted area to protect against additional loss. Use towels or mops to absorb excess water, and open windows to promote airflow. If it's secure, switch on dehumidifiers or followers to speed up drying out. Do not neglect to document the damage with images for insurance coverage functions. It's smart to call experts who can give customized devices and expertise if the situation is extreme. Keep in mind, fast action can make a significant distinction in the outcome of your restoration efforts.

Evaluating the Source of Water Intrusion
Just how can you effectively pinpoint the resource of water breach in your house? Start by checking your residential property for noticeable indications of wetness, such as spots on ceilings or wall surfaces. Check the foundation, roofing system, and any type of subjected pipes for leaks or damage. Pay interest to locations around home windows and doors where water could seep in throughout heavy rain.Next, take into consideration the weather. Heavy storms or melting snow can bring about flooding, so determine if recent climate patterns might be an element. If you suspect plumbing issues, switch off your water system and check your water meter for any kind of unexplained increases.Also, try to find mold development, which frequently suggests longstanding dampness issues. Advanced Devices Usage
While water damages can damage your residential property, using advanced tools for reliable water extraction can significantly reduce the impact. High-powered pumps and industrial-grade vacuums rapidly eliminate standing water, avoiding more damages. Utilizing wetness meters helps you analyze the extent of the issue and target locations requiring interest. Dehumidifiers work to decrease moisture degrees, making certain that wetness does not stick around, which might result in mold and mildew growth. Infrared electronic cameras can discover hidden water pockets behind walls and under floorings, allowing you to address problems before they rise. By purchasing this advanced modern technology, you can improve the remediation procedure, reduce healing time, and guard your home versus future water-related concerns.

Complete Drying and Dehumidification Processes
When water damage takes place, proper drying and dehumidification are crucial to preventing additional problems like mold growth and structural damages. You need to act promptly, as the longer wetness lingers, the worse the damages can come to be. Beginning by getting rid of standing water making use of pumps and wet vacuums to get rid of the bulk of the moisture.Next, use high-powered fans and dehumidifiers to ensure thorough drying of influenced areas, including walls, floors, and furniture. Keep home windows closed to prevent outside moisture from complicating the procedure. Screen moisture levels with a hygrometer, going for a family member humidity listed below 50%. Checking surprise areas, like behind wall surfaces and under floorings, is vital, as dampness can hide there. On a regular basis assess the drying development and readjust your equipment as required. Remember, reliable drying out isn't almost speed; it's about ensuring every square inch of your room is moisture-free to avoid future issues.
Mold Avoidance and Removal Strategies
To avoid mold development after water damages, it's important to apply proactive approaches quickly. Start by completely drying out impacted areas within 24 to 48 hours. Use fans and dehumidifiers to eliminate moisture from walls, carpets, and furnishings. Validate correct air flow, as this assists minimize humidity degrees and prevents mold development.Next, check for concealed leakages and address them without delay. Act swiftly to remediate it if you discover mold. Put on protective equipment, including masks and handwear covers, and use a combination of water and cleaning agent to clean small affected areas. For bigger infestations, consider employing an expert mold and mildew remediation service.Additionally, treat surface areas with mold-resistant items to offer additional defense. Frequently check possible trouble locations, like washrooms and basements, for indicators of wetness. By taking these steps, you can significantly decrease the danger of mold and mildew and validate a much safer, healthier living environment.

What Insurance Policy Insurance Coverage Applies to Water Damage Reconstruction?
Your homeowners insurance commonly covers abrupt water damage, like burst pipelines. However, it usually excludes flooding damages. Always examine your plan's specifics and consider additional flood insurance for considerable defense against water-related concerns.
